How they compare
Cameroon currently reports 354,162 against 326,470 in Mali, a difference of 27,692.
That makes Cameroon's figure about 1.1 times Mali's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 66 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Mali ahead.
Cameroon ranks 41st and Mali ranks 43rd of 217 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Cameroon averaged higher in 6 and Mali in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Cameroon | Mali |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 59,975 | 62,692 | 2,717 | Mali |
| 1970s | 80,932 | 74,870 | 6,062 | Cameroon |
| 1980s | 114,224 | 95,897 | 18,327 | Cameroon |
| 1990s | 160,696 | 128,788 | 31,907 | Cameroon |
| 2000s | 209,242 | 162,391 | 46,851 | Cameroon |
| 2010s | 266,055 | 224,674 | 41,382 | Cameroon |
| 2020s | 336,273 | 302,154 | 34,119 | Cameroon |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
